Warning: This is where mobile speed cameras will be sited in July

Drivers are being alerted to the location of mobile speed cameras on Gloucestershire roads in July.

The sites have been revealed by the county's Road Safety Mobile Camera Enforcement Unit which is committed to reducing risks to road users caused by vehicles travelling at excessive speeds.

Priority sites for July 2018 are:

• Church Road, Leckhampton

• Leckhampton Road, Cheltenham

• A40 Sherborne

• A417 Burford Road Junction Swindon Bound

• A40 Farmington Oxford Bound

• A417 Burford Road Junction Gloucester Bound

• A40 Farmington Cheltenham Bound

They will endeavour to visit other mobile enforcement sites throughout the county, but motorists should expect a regular presence at these sites throughout July.
